Warm weather has followed the rains and wildflowers are already putting on quite a show. A walk on a coastal bluff could bring visions of exquisite beauty.

And forests have their share of wildflowers too. False Solomon Seal just began blooming. It's a member of the Lily family.

And here is an emerging Andrew's Clintonia, Clintonia andrewsiana, also called a Red Clintonia, It too is a member of the Lily family and, if the flower isn't eaten by a Deer, the beautiful blossoms will bloom the first of May.
